2 Pluspunkte 0 Minuspunkte
Wie kann ich ein Linux Bash Script mit Parametern aufrufen?
von  

1 Antwort

3 Pluspunkte 0 Minuspunkte

Du kannst Argumente mithilfe von sogenannten "Positional Parameters" verarbeiten. Diese werden im Skript als $1, $2, $3 usw. referenziert, wobei $1 den ersten Parameter, $2 den zweiten und so weiter darstellt. $# beinhaltet die Anzahl an übergebenen Argumenten.

#!/bin/bash

# Überprüfe, ob genug Parameter übergeben wurden
if [ $# -lt 2 ]; then
    echo "Zu wenige Parameter. Benutzung: $0 param1 param2"
    exit 1
fi

# Verarbeite die Parameter
param1=$1
param2=$2

# Hier kannst du mit param1 und param2 arbeiten
echo "Parameter 1: $param1"
echo "Parameter 2: $param2"

von (706 Punkte)